CLEVELAND, Ohio — The Browns defense solid until the fourth quarter during Sunday’s 41-17 loss to the Ravens .

Here’s how the defense graded according to Pro Football Focus:

( PFF grades every player on every play and uses a scale of 0-100, with higher grades indicating better play. PFF has explained its grades this way: 100-90 elite; 89-85 Pro Bowler; 84-70 starter; 69-60 backup; 59-0 replaceable. In other words, it’s similar to how we would match up percentages with traditional letter grades in school.)
